Delta Airlines to retire its 777 fleet

Delta Airlines (DL/DAL) has said that it plans to retire all of its Boeing 777 aircraft by the end of 2020. The Atlanta Hartsfield based airline currently has 18 Boeing 777-200 aircraft in its fleet. 10 of which are the Long-Range (200LR) variant. Delta says that decision is a strategic [read more]

Virgin Atlantic aims to operate 31 routes in Summer 2021

Virgin Atlantic (VS/VIR) has released details of its planned flying programme for Summer 2021 with a total of 31 routes planned. The majority of the flights (24) will operate from London Heathrow (LHR/EGLL) while the rest will operate from Belfast (BFS/EGAA), Glasgow (GLA/EGPF) and Manchester (MAN/EGCC). Brussels Airlines cuts jobs and fleet

Brussels Airlines (SN/BEL) has announced it will cut 1,000 jobs and reduce its fleet size by one-third as it restructures to deal with the global crisis caused by the Coronavirus Pandemic.
